Transaction 12f107fbe560dd4da29f4953bf8f766645c92b05d747c8e6f7b5e8c87e2e129e
1 Input
2 Outputs
- 12f107fbe560dd4da29f4953bf8f766645c92b05d747c8e6f7b5e8c87e2e129e:0
- 12f107fbe560dd4da29f4953bf8f766645c92b05d747c8e6f7b5e8c87e2e129e:1
value 40158
address 1FH7FgyBRLRx7nmXwSUDUbgznbAL83Trk4
value 469414
address 36u4n3QU6YrNwhHcNVfdGdR8ERF27aFLzj